"The Ladies' Work-Book" by Unknown is a late 1800's how-to guide showcasing needlework. It's especially for women looking to learn knitting, crochet, and point lace. It gives easy-to-follow directions and pictures to assist in learning. The handbook likely teaches how to make trendy and practical things for the home. The aim catered to women's dreams of creating a comfortable home. The book starts with knitting, explaining that many women enjoy it, giving basic lessons on how to cast on, knit, and do a purl stitch. Readers are told that it’s easy to learn, plus there are diagrams to help beginners. Moving through the section, it explains patterns and projects, like a baby shoe and mats, giving hands-on tips while encouraging women to try these old-fashioned crafts.
